Tahlee is a moderate growth suburb in Mid-Coast, NSW 2324, about 154km from Sydney CBD. Recent property sales in Tahlee are too limited to report a reliable median price. The suburb has no schools recorded, a transport score of 0/100, and is right by the coast. Tahlee has an overall score of 17/100, based on transport, liveability and education. Suburb-level crime data isn't available for a safety score here.
